Objectives: The objective of the tender is to hire a creative content producer to document the impact of UNDP's early recovery interventions in Northeast Nigeria. The selected media firm will produce powerful audio-visual materials documenting human impact stories from conflict-affected communities in the Adamawa, Borno, and Yobe states. The content will be used to enhance visibility and awareness of the project's outcomes, focusing on improved livelihood and economic opportunities, restored basic services, and strengthened social cohesion and community security. Deliverables include interviews, high-resolution photos, creative videos, and promotional content for social media.
